ADC_Keywords: Atomic physics Keywords: atomic data - atomic processes - radiation mechanisms: non-thermal - planetary nebulae: general - infrared: general Abstract: We present electron collision strengths and their thermally averaged values for the nebular forbidden lines of the astronomically abundant doubly ionized oxygen ion, O2+, in an intermediate coupling scheme using the Breit-Pauli relativistic terms as implemented in an R-MATRIX atomic scattering code. We use several atomic targets for the R-MATRIX scattering calculations including one with 72 atomic terms. We also compare with new results obtained using the 20 intermediate coupling frame transformation method. We find spectroscopically significant differences against a recent Breit-Pauli calculation for the excitation of the [OIII] λ4363 transition but confirm the results of earlier calculations. Description: The data set consists of ten files which are labeled as 'OMEGAmn_OIII.dat' where m=1,2,3,4 and n=2,3,4,5 with m<n. The indices m and n refer to the level index as given in the note. In each file the first column represents the electron excitation energy in Rydberg and the second column represents the collision strength for the transition between the indicated levels.
